Maybe this has already been addressed, but please help - Am I understanding the CIP rules correctly? If we have a current (existing) customer who, say, has a loan with us and he comes in to open up a checking account, then we have to perform CIP procedures on him again?

You need to see what your policy says in this regard. In general, the USA Patriot Act says that for an existing customer (another account currently open) you do not have to re-CIP him when another account is being opened if you have a reasonable belief that you know his identity.
